&lt;div&gt;&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;The Enduring Appeal of uPVC Doors and Windows: A Comprehensive Guide&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;In the realm of home improvement and building, the option of windows and doors plays a critical role in shaping both the visual appeal and functional efficiency of a building. Amongst the myriad of products available, Unplasticized Polyvinyl Chloride, more typically referred to as uPVC, has emerged as a frontrunner for doors and windows in modern homes and commercial spaces alike. This short article digs into the world of uPVC doors and windows, exploring their structure, benefits, types, and why they continue to be a favoured option for homeowners seeking sturdiness, energy effectiveness, and design.&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;Comprehending uPVC: The Material Behind the Magic&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;uPVC represents Unplasticized Polyvinyl Chloride. To understand what makes uPVC unique, it&#039;s useful to first look at its base material, PVC (Polyvinyl Chloride). PVC is a commonly used artificial plastic polymer known for its adaptability. However, uPVC differs from basic PVC due to the &#039;unplasticized&#039; aspect. This implies that plasticizers, which are contributed to make PVC more versatile, are not utilized in uPVC. The lack of plasticizers leads to a stiff, strong, and durable material that is incredibly well-suited for building and construction applications, especially for doors and windows.&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;The core composition of uPVC usually includes:&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;Polyvinyl Chloride Resin: The basic structure block, supplying the standard structure and attributes of the product.Stabilizers: These are contributed to improve the product&#039;s resistance to heat, UV radiation, and weathering, guaranteeing durability and colour retention.Modifiers: These enhance impact resistance and workability, making the uPVC simpler to make and more robust in usage.Pigments: These offer colour to the uPVC, permitting a variety of aesthetic options without the requirement for painting.&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;This unique solution gives [https://templeton-ewing-5.technetbloggers.de/the-top-reasons-people-succeed-within-the-window-door-company-industry/ Upvc Doors Windows] its intrinsic strength and resistance to numerous environmental elements, making it an ideal choice for external doors and windows that are continuously exposed to the elements.&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;The Plethora of Benefits: Why Choose uPVC?&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;The popularity of uPVC windows and doors originates from a compelling combination of advantages they provide. They often include ornamental panels, glass inserts, and robust locking mechanisms.uPVC Back Doors: Typically resulting in gardens or backyards, these doors focus on security and functionality, often with simpler styles than front doors however keeping the same sturdiness and energy efficiency.uPVC Patio Doors: Designed to provide seamless access to outside areas, patio doors been available in different configurations:uPVC Sliding Patio Doors: These doors slide horizontally, conserving space and offering large openings. They are ideal for making the most of light and views.uPVC French Doors: These doors include 2 surrounding doors that open outwards (or inwards), producing a grand, conventional look and a large, unobstructed opening.uPVC Bi-fold Doors: These doors fold back in sections like concertina doors, developing an extremely wide opening and flawlessly linking indoor and outdoor spaces.&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;uPVC Window Types:&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;uPVC Casement [http://italianculture.net/redir.php?url=https://ucgp.jujuy.edu.ar/profile/brownfear9/ windows and doors uk]: These windows are hinged on the side and open outwards, using exceptional ventilation and a clear, unblocked view. They are understood for their airtight seals and energy effectiveness.uPVC Tilt and Turn Windows: These flexible windows can both tilt inwards for ventilation and completely open inwards for simple cleansing and optimum airflow. They are popular for their functionality and security features.uPVC Sliding Windows: Similar to sliding doors, these windows include sashes that move horizontally within the frame. They are space-saving and simple to operate, ideal for locations where outwards opening windows are not possible.uPVC Awning Windows: Hinged at the top and opening outwards, these windows provide ventilation even throughout light rain, as they produce a protective awning.uPVC Fixed Windows: These windows do not open and are created entirely to let in light. They are often utilized in combination with other window types to produce large glazed locations.&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;Installation and Maintenance: Ensuring Longevity and Performance&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;While uPVC is inherently long lasting, proper setup is vital to optimizing its advantages and making sure long-term efficiency.
